Vietnam Sends a Sapper Unit to UN Peacekeeping Operations for the First Time
Vietnam’s sapper unit No. 1 and level-2 field hospital No. 4 joining UN peacekeeping operations made their debut at a ceremony held by the Ministry of National Defence in Hanoi on November 17.

The unit was established in 2014 and it takes charge of peacekeeping missions when requested by the United Nations Since 2014.
Major General Hoang Kim Phung, Director of the Vietnam Department of Peacekeeping Operations, said that the preparation for the sapper unit was adjusted regularly to meet the requirements of the UN’s peacekeeping mission. Initially, there were 268 people, then increased to 319 people and now there are 203 people (21 women) in the unit.
Up to now, the level-2 field hospital No. 4 has 71 people who were selected from different units across the whole army.
The hospital focuses on learning English, military-medical, and other training courses organized by the Vietnam Department of Peacekeeping Operations in 2021. The staff of the hospital will participate in additional training courses on medical, peacekeeping, pre-deployment, and military services in the future.
Along with the level-2 field hospital, Vietnam's first sapper unit will contribute to providing humanitarian aid, helping the United Nations Peacekeeping perform their tasks, contributing to peacekeeping and national reconstruction, bringing peace to the host countries, as well as protecting the motherland.

On behalf of the Central Military Commission and the Ministry of National Defense, Senior Lieutenant General Hoang Xuan Chien acknowledged the efforts of agencies and units in the Ministry of National Defense, especially the Vietnam Department of Peacekeeping Operations, Military Hospital 175, Vietnam Military Medical University, and sapper arm in peacekeeping process.
Senior Lieutenant General Hoang Xuan Chien requested relevant units to complete all-around preparations for the sapper unit No. 1 and the level-2 field No. 4 and organize more training courses before deployment.

On this occasion, the US handed over the transient instructor and student accommodation facility S8 to the Vietnam Department of Peacekeeping Operations.
